I've checked my i9 9900k with a 3080 ti at various resolutions. It lags behind newer CPUs only at 1080p. At 4K it performs similarly across the board. For context, I'm using an EVGA XC3 Ultra 3080 ti. Against a Ryzen 5800x, it achieves around 143fps in 1440p and 160fps in 1080p. With Horizon Zero Dawn, it's about 128fps, while the 5800x hits 129fps. Assassin's Creed Odyssey averages 90fps on the 5800x versus 93fps on the i9. Shadow of the Tomb Raider reaches 143fps, and Horizon Zero Dawn is 142fps. At 1080p, things change significantly. The SOTTR i9 9900k clocks at 168fps, while the 5800x hits 183fps. The MSI Gaming X Trio 3090 with an i9 10900k edges out slightly, but no real jump. With a high-end 3080 ti (FTW3 Ultra), my 5900x achieves 203fps, placing it well ahead of the i9 9900k. At 1440p, it matches the 5800x performance. The i9 12900k could be an upgrade, but unless you're a 1080p enthusiast, the Ryzen 5000s and 11th-gen Intel chips still fall short.
